    Hello bees!

    I read this website daily, and get so many ideas (maybe too many, haha).  So I was hoping y'all could help me with my theme, or rather how to ties things together.  A quick background: I'm getting married November 2010 in Austin at a Catholic Church and then the reception is at the Salt Lick Pavilion.  It's a wonderful rustic building, so I'm trying to go with a rustic elegant feel.  My colors are eggplant (dark purple), charcoal gray, and ivory.  I want there to be corks as the escort cards and wine bottles as the table numbers and then flowers and lots of candles.  Then I also want there to be a couple of manzanita crystal trees (also to be used at the church) at the guest signing table.

    I know so get to the point...the Pavilion provides boots with flowers in them, which I was hoping to line the walk way to the pavilion (I'm going to attach a picture).  My BM pointed out that doing the boots (on the outside) and then 2 crystal trees and wine bottles (on the inside) doesn't really flow together.  I guess my question is there a way to link all of this together? Or am I just going to have to get rid of 1) the boots or 2) the trees and crystal idea?

    I would love y'alls thoughts! And sorry for such a long read.

    I don't think people are going to pay THAT close of attention to the outside vs. inside decor.  If the building is rustic, that will tie the boots in.  And since the reception area is a separate space, I don't think it will conflict.

    Otherwise- what about having the boots filled with vines (ie vineyard) or bunches of grapes (even fake ones maybe) to tie in with the wine theme.
